Barrie takes steps to advance defence investment readiness |
|
|
|
|
On May 28, Mayor Alex Nuttall issued a Mayoral Direction to position Barrie as a leader in defence investment readiness. The City of Barrie is ready to support Federal and Provincial efforts to attract new opportunities in the defence, security, and advanced manufacturing sectors, to help boost Canada’s military capabilities. |

New Employment Development CIP supports job-creating development projects in Barrie |
|
|
|
|
The Employment Development Community Improvement Plan (CIP) helps businesses grow and invest in Barrie through financial incentives that support job creation and economic development. Programs include planning and building permit fee grants, study grants, Employment Ready Reviews, and the Tax Increment Equivalent Grant (TIEG) program to help reduce development costs for eligible projects. |

Company moving head office to Barrie after acquiring JEBCO Industries |
|
Toronto-headquartered River Birch Global Water has acquired Barrie-based JEBCO Industries, a full-service process equipment manufacturer and provider of advanced cladding technology. As part of the acquisition, River Birch will relocate its head office from Toronto to Barrie and join JEBCO’s local team, strengthening its capabilities in engineered water and wastewater treatment systems. |

Barrie-founded battery company wins Sustainability Award for innovation |
|
Better Battery Co. has been named a winner of the Canadian Business Innovation Award in the Sustainability category, presented by Canadian Business in partnership with Maclean’s, recognizing companies driving meaningful innovation and impact across Canada. Since launching in 2021, the company has developed the world’s first carbon-neutral alkaline battery with a built-in recycling program. |

Barrie unveils future Performing Arts Centre at downtown waterfront |
|
The City of Barrie is moving forward with a new 45,000 sq. ft. performing arts and convention centre, set to become a major cultural hub. The $85-million facility will include a 600-seat performance hall and a 200-seat rehearsal and events studio. Groundbreaking is expected in 2027, with completion planned for mid-2029. |

- CanExport SMEs funding program: The application window for the 2026–2027 intake has been extended to August 31, 2026 at 12:00 PM (ET). The CanExport SMEs program offers competitive funding to help eligible Canadian small and medium-sized enterprises expand into new international markets.
- Ontario Together Trade Fund (OTTF): Accepting applications. Supports small and medium-sized businesses making near-term investments to expand into new markets, reshore critical supply chains, and strengthen trade resilience amid U.S. tariffs.
- Government of Canada $1.5 Billion New Funding: Supports tariff-impacted industries such as steel, aluminum, and copper to adapt, compete, and invest in growth and diversification. Includes a $1 billion Business Development Bank of Canada (BDC) program and $500 million for the Regional Tariff Response Initiative (RTRI).
- Future Ready Program: Rolling applications open, up to $10k available. Supports companies that are looking to upskill or reskill existing staff to support the adoption of Critical Technologies and commercialize new products or services for key sectors.
- Southwestern Ontario Development Fund: Provides support for projects and investments to existing businesses, municipalities and not-for-profit organizations for economic development in southwestern Ontario. Application deadline: September 23, 2026.
- Regional Development Program: Advanced Manufacturing and Innovation Competitiveness Stream: The Advanced Manufacturing and Innovation Competitiveness (AMIC) Stream will provide financial support to advanced manufacturing companies with a focus on small and medium-sized enterprises across Ontario.
- Industrial AI Readiness Program: In partnership with NRC-IRAP, the program will provide eligible Canadian manufacturers with a reimbursement of up to $15,000 to adopt AI to improve the productivity, health and safety, and environmental performance of their production systems.
- International Emergency Economic Powers Act (IEEPA) Duty Refunds: Accepting applications. Importers who paid U.S. tariffs under IEEPA, which have since been ruled unlawful by U.S. courts, may be eligible to apply for a refund from the U.S. government.
- Ontario Defence Association (ODA): Membership applications are open. Ontario’s first dedicated defence industry association focused on strengthening collaboration across industry, government, and innovation stakeholders.
- EMC’s National Defence Consortium: Expression of interest is open. Canada’s largest manufacturing consortium is building a national network connecting manufacturers to defence opportunities, industry insights, and key ecosystem partners, helping businesses access supply chains and grow in the defence sector.
